A basic small potager garden will require just a few simple tools and supplies.

A basic small potager garden will require just a few simple tools and supplies. A spade or shovel is necessary to dig and amend the soil, while a rake is used to sweep the leaves and debris away. A garden fork is also helpful for turning over the soil. Finally, a watering can is necessary to regularly water the plants.

Consider using a mix of annuals and perennials in a small space to create a personalized Eden.

A small garden can be enjoyed beautifully with a mix of annual and perennial plants. Annuals provide a burst of color and life, while perennials provide stability and long-term beauty. Choose a variety of plants that will complement each other in both color and texture. Include plants that bloom in different seasons, as well as those with different needs like sun or shade. If you have limited space, try to keep your planting mix diverse in shape as well. A mix of shrubs, trees and groundcover flowers will create a natural looking garden that is easy to care for.
